Information About History

Izola is a city located in the Primorska region of Slovenia. Located on the coast of the Adriatic Sea, this city is famous for its historical and cultural riches. Izola's history dates back to the Roman Empire. The city served as an important port city during the Roman period. It later came under the rule of various powers such as the Byzantine Empire, the Frankish Kingdom and the Republic of Venice. In the Middle Ages, Izola became an important trading centre. The city, which was under the control of the Republic of Venice, grew with maritime trade and fishing activities. Many historical buildings were built during this period. In the 19th century, Izola became part of the Austro-Hungarian Empire. During this period, the city stood out with its touristic appeal and became the summer residence of the rich. Izola's historical texture is still preserved today. In the historical center of the city, there are narrow streets, old houses and churches dating back to the Middle Ages. Tourist Attractions

Izola is a city located on the Adriatic Sea coast of Slovenia. Izola Municipality covers the city of Izola and several smaller settlements around it. The city is famous for its historical and cultural richness, beautiful beaches and delicious seafood. Tourist attractions to visit in Izola include:

1. Izola Historical Center: The historical center of the city has a fascinating atmosphere with its narrow streets, colorful houses and historical buildings. Here St. You can see important structures such as Maurus Cathedral, Manzioli Palace and Veliki Trg (Grand Square).

2. Port: Izola's port is the center of the city's vitality. B. You can find fishing boats, yachts and seafood restaurants there. Wandering around the harbor is a great option for walking along the seaside with beautiful views.

3. Beaches: Izola has many beautiful beaches along its coastline. You can sunbathe and swim at beaches such as Belvedere, Simonov Zaliv and Delfin Beach. Sea water is generally clean and clear, so it is an ideal place for swimming.

4. Soline Salt Ponds: Located near Izola, Soline Salt Ponds are protected as a natural reserve. Salt is produced here and the water in the ponds provides a suitable environment for salt aquatic plants and bird species to live. You can walk in this area and discover natural beauties.

5. Parenzana Cycle Path: Izola is located on Parenzana, Slovenia's popular bicycle route. This historic railway line is a beautiful cycle path that follows old train stations, tunnels and bridges. You can explore this route by renting a bike from Izola. Economic Information

Izola is a city located on the coastline of Slovenia, bordering the Adriatic Sea. Tourism, fishing and maritime industries play an important role in the city's economy. The tourism industry is the mainstay of Izola's economy. The city attracts tourists with its historical and cultural heritage, beautiful beaches and harbour. Izola, which attracts intense interest from tourists especially in the summer months, creates employment with its hotels, restaurants and other tourism facilities. The fishing industry also holds an important place in Izola's economy. The city has a fishing tradition and fishing activities are an important source of income. The fish market is a popular spot for tourists and locals in the city to enjoy fresh fish. It is a point where he buys trace products. The maritime sector also holds an important place in Izola's economy. The port is used for freight and passenger transportation. In addition, yacht tourism is also developing and the port is a point where yachts anchor. The agricultural sector is also part of the economic activities in Izola. Especially olive and grape cultivation are among the important agricultural activities. Olive groves and vineyards in the city are a source of income for local producers.
